  • This Residence Embraces Tradition with Stone Clad Walls | Gaurav Deore Architects

    Set in the serene landscape of Nashik, the Dabholkar Residence by GDA is a home, embracing stone clad walls. Here, tradition and contemporary design exist in harmony. Designed to reflect the family’s deep connection to tradition and art while embracing the style of contemporary living, it is a space where architectural details, heritage furniture, artwork and natural surroundings come together seamlessly.

    Traditional Architectural Elements

    The architectural expression is grounded in natural materials, with stone clad walls of facade and a pitched roof that lends an understated yet timeless character.

    Verandah Design

    The verandah, paved in polished marble, acts as a threshold between indoors and out. As an element of vada-style architecture, the verandah is framed by wooden columns with a rough stone base, offering a shaded retreat overlooking the garden, where the family gathers for morning tea or quiet moments of reflection. The transition into the home is fluid, with open layouts that allow light and air to flow freely through the spaces.

    Interior Design

    Inside, the interiors unfold as a composition of carefully balanced heritage elements, bespoke finishes, and thoughtful contemporary interventions.

    Living Area

    The living room is centered around a collection of traditional wooden sofas with floral upholstery, juxtaposed with modern seating in muted tones to create a layered aesthetic.

    Dining Area Design

    The dining area continues this narrative of understated elegance, with intricately carved wooden columns lending a sense of continuity. A bespoke wooden table is paired with vibrant blue upholstered chairs, creating a striking contrast against the neutral palette. Above, an antique chandelier enhances the ambiance, while adjacent cabinetry balances aesthetics with functionality. Wooden columns with intricately carved brackets subtly define the space without enclosing it, maintaining a sense of openness and fluidity.

    Incorporating Artworks

    Beyond its thoughtful design, the home showcases a carefully curated collection of original paintings and artworks. The client’s selection includes works by renowned artists such as Seema Kohli, Thota Vaikuntam, Raja Ravi Varma, and Senaka Senanayke, among others.

    Original Pichhwai paintings further enhance the interiors, bringing a sense of tradition and artistic expression to the spaces. These cherished pieces are an integral part of the home, adding a touch of personality, style and artistic flair.

    Fact File

    Designed by: Gaurav Deore Architects

    Project Type: Residential Architecture & Interior Design

    Project Name: Dabholkar House

    Location: Nashik

    Year Built: 2023-2024

    Duration of the project: 13 Months

    Project Size: 6000 Sq.ft

    Principal Architects: Ar. Gaurav Deore & Pritam Deore

    Design Credits: Ar. Pooja Jangid

    Photograph Courtesy: Yadnyesh Joshi & Sabastian Zachariah

    Interior Styling: GDA Workspace / Ashlesha Dabholkar

    Products / Materials / Vendors: Finishes – Veneer& Paint / Wallcovering / Cladding –Nilaya Sabyasachi Wallpaper & painting by Various Artist Such as Thota Vaikuntam, Raja Ravi Varma, Seema Kohli, Sachin Sagare, Senaka Senanayake, Nagesh Goud etc. / Lighting – Brass custom Chandeliers / Doors and Partitions – Veneer finish Neoclassical Door / Sanitaryware – By Toto / Facade Systems –Exterior Cladding – Sandstone / Windows – Aluminum System Window / Furniture – Teakwood Mid Century Modern Furniture / Flooring –Ascon White Marble / Paint –Asian Paints / Artefacts –Curated Artefacts sourced from various place such as London, China, Bali, Czech Republic Bangalore , Jaipur ,Dehradun etc. Wallpaper –-Nilaya Sabyasachi Wallpaper / Hardware –Blum / Hafele
